TMC protests outside Parliament, Rajya Sabha adjourned

| | Jul 09, 2014, at 04:46 pm
New Delhi, July 9 (IBNS): Trinamool Congress MPs on Wednesday protested outside the Parliament against alleged attack on them by ruling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) lawmakers during the budget speech a day ago, a charge that has been strongly denied by the BJP.

TMC MPs like Kalyan Banerjee, Kakoli Ghosh Dastidar, Shatabdi Roy, Derek O'Brien and others were seen raising slogans against the alleged attack on them along with placards denouncing the railway budget and fare hikes.

"The government is doing nothing to stop price rise which is affecting the poor and common people," said Kakoli Ghosh Dastidar speaking to media who on Tuesday alleged that she was attacked by the BJP inside Parliament.

Trinamool Congress protest also led to adjournment of the Rajya Sabha on Wednesday while slogan shouting disrupted the proceedings in Lok Sabha.

Trinamool Congress MPs on Tuesday alleged that they were physically threatened and attacked by the BJP members inside Parliament during the Railway Budget speech as TV footage showed several TMC lawmakers rushing out of the House and seeking help.

TMC was angry with no announcement for West Bengal in the budget and had disrupted the speech of Railway Minister Sadananda Gowda leading to the ruckus.

TMC MP Kalyan Banerjee was seen rushing out and running outside followed by several other TMC MPs. He said the BJP MPs tried to beat them up and terrorised the women MPs.

Trinamool MP Kakoli Ghosh Dastidar said a drunk BJP MP threatened them. BJP, however, denied it completely.

BJP MP Harish Dwivedi, accused of the attack, said they had done nothing but only intervened when TMC MPs abused Narendra Modi and called his budget one on "Adani model"

According to reports, BJP lawmaker Kalraj Mishra prevented his lawmaker from turning violent.
